The ingredients needed to prepare Lemon Sevai:
  1. You need 2 cups rice noodles
  2. Provide 2 Tbsp Oil
  3. Provide 1/2 tsp Mustard seeds
  4. Get 1/2 tsp Urad Dal
  5. Get 1/2 tsp Bengal Gram Dal
  6. Prepare 2 Medium size Onions chopped
  7. You need 2 Green Chillies slit
  8. You need 2 Dry Red Chillies slit
  9. Provide 1/2 tsp Turmeric powder
  10. Provide Curry leaves few
  11. Prepare Coriander leaves few
  12. Get 1 Lemon (Juice)
  13. Provide Salt-as per your taste
Instructions to make Lemon Sevai:

  2. Place a saute pan in the stove. Switch on the flame. Add oil.
  3. Once oil gets heat add mustard seeds,bengal gram dal and urad dal fry it.
  4. Then add onions, chillies,curry leaves and turmeric powder. Saute until onions becomes translucent.
  5. Keep the flame low and add rice noodles. Add lemon juice and mix well. If needed you can add more lemon juice. Check for salt if needed add salt.
  6. Garnish with coriander leaves.Lemon Sevai/Lemon Noodles is ready to serve.
  7. Serve with peanut chutney or green coconut chutney or red coconut chutney.
